We all fall short of the Glory of God. We all sometimes lose the right way when we are angry, extremely sad, and even when we are happy. Sometimes when we are happy and things are going great we leave God out of it.

The point is to learn from your mistakes and sins and work on a way to change your reaction to the situation that made you angry. Try your best to do as God would have you do in all situations, but most importantly...

Pray and ask God to lead you, teach you, talk to you and show you the way in which He would have you go. And ask Him to give you the strength to do His will over yours. That doesn't just mean actions but also emotions and reactions.
